What Is EXION Skin Tightening?
EXION is a non-invasive, advanced radiofrequency treatment that uses radiofrequency and targeted ultrasound energy to support skin rejuvenation. EXION is a treatment that may improve skin texture, reduce the appearance of facial wrinkles, and support natural production of collagen, elastin, and hyaluronic acid.
Because EXION is non-surgical, there are no incisions and no surgical downtime. Patients may feel warmth during treatment, and individual experiences can vary, but it is designed as a comfortable in-office treatment that allows patients to return to normal routines.
How Radiofrequency And Ultrasound Energy Support Firmer Skin
Radiofrequency energy is used in aesthetics to heat targeted layers of tissue. When used appropriately, that heat can stimulate fibroblast activity and support collagen production. Collagen and elastin are important because they help skin look firmer, smoother, and more resilient.
EXION also incorporates ultrasound energy. The combination helps treat skin concerns below the skin’s surface while keeping the procedure non-invasive. The goal is not to make someone look dramatically different. The goal is to support healthier-looking skin quality, improved firmness, and more natural-looking rejuvenation.

EXION Vs. Surgery And Other Skin Tightening Treatments
EXION is not a surgical facelift and does not remove excess skin. A board-certified plastic surgeon may be appropriate for patients with more advanced laxity or goals that require surgical lifting. EXION is more suited to patients who want a non-surgical approach to skin rejuvenation and firmness. Exion is frequently layered on to EMface treatments when a nonsurgical lift is also desired.
Compared with laser resurfacing, EXION focuses more on tightening support and deeper tissue stimulation, while lasers may be chosen for pigmentation, sun damage, texture, or resurfacing goals. Compared with microneedling, EXION does not rely on creating micro-channels in the same way. Compared with Emtone, EXION is typically discussed for skin rejuvenation and tightening, while Emtone is often considered for cellulite and body texture concerns.

What to Expect During an EXION Visit
Before treatment, your provider will review your medical history, skin concerns, aesthetic goals, treatment area, and recent procedures. Jewelry or piercings may need to be removed from the treatment area. A conductive gel may be applied, and the applicator is moved over the skin while energy is delivered.
Patients typically feel warmth, not pain. Session length can vary depending on the treated areas and treatment plan. Because there is no downtime, EXION can be appealing for busy professionals, parents, and patients who want a non-surgical option that fits into normal life.
Who May Be a Good Candidate?
A good candidate for EXION may be someone with mild to moderate laxity, fine lines, uneven texture, early signs of aging, or a desire for non-surgical skin rejuvenation. It may also fit patients who want to maintain skin quality over time rather than wait until laxity becomes more advanced.
Patients with significant excess skin, major weight loss, or goals requiring tissue repositioning may need to discuss surgical procedures instead. The best plan depends on anatomy, skin tone, skin texture, treatment history, and realistic expectations.
